Manual Differential Normal Ranges. Why do you need a manual differential. according to the world health organization (who), normal references for hemoglobin levels are 13 to 18 g/dl in adult men and 12 to 16. a blood differential test measures the amount of each type of white blood cell (wbc) that you have in your body. Knowing these levels can help a doctor. The different types of white blood cells are given as a percentage of all white cells: What is a cbc with differential? the differential blood test tells doctors how many of each type of white blood cell are in the body. a differential blood count gives the relative percentage of each type of white blood cell and also helps to reveal abnormal white blood cell. what is a manual differential blood test?
